News / Thousands take to streets as Israel celebrates 60 years of statehood
By Haaretz Staff and Channel 10
Tags: Ehud Olmert, Shimon Peres 
Haaretz.com/Channel 10 news roundup for May 8, 2008.

In this edition:

Thousands take to the streets and parks as Israel celebrates 60 years of statehood.

In Independence Day festivities, Prime Minister Ehud Olmert appears unaffected by the new probe against him.

President Shimon Peres conveys an optimistic message in a special holiday interview.
